Wine Advocate
"92 pts ... Purple-colored with legs that coat the glass, it exhibits an expressive nose of balsam wood, smoke, spice box, lavender, and black cherry. This leads to a medium-bodied, elegant style of Malbec with plenty of savory fruit and incipient complexity." Stephen Tanzer
"90 pts ... Good deep full ruby. Very expressive aromas of blueberry, violet, menthol, graphite and dark chocolate. In a rather extractive, hedonistic style,...offering sweet, sexy, high-toned flavors of cola, sassafras and violet. Finishes supple, sweet and long, with very fine-grained tannins." Winemaker's Notes
"Aromas of smoky oak and cherry. Mouthwatering, penetrating flavors of ripe red and black cherries, red berries. Quite rich and velvety on the palate, and finishes with just enough grip to make it a real winner with food. This is some seriously sexy Malbec. Pairs well with grilled or smoked meats such as beef, pork, and lamb. Also complements dishes prepared with cheese or cream sauces." Technical Notes
"From vineyards at 3,150 feet average altitude, 42 year old vines. Hand-harvested, no press wine. 12 months in 60% new French and 40% second-use French barriques. Unfined, unfiltered. 14.4% alc." 13.9% alc. |
